




版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
《job使用说明》本指南将指导您了解如何使用job系统。job系统是一个强大的工具,可以帮助您管理工作流程。课程简介实用性强本课程注重实践操作,旨在帮助学员快速掌握Job使用技巧,并能将其应用到实际工作中。内容丰富课程内容涵盖Job的基础知识、进阶技巧、常见问题解决方案、最佳实践等。案例驱动课程通过大量实际案例,帮助学员理解Job的应用场景,并提升解决问题的能力。课程目标掌握Job基础知识了解Job概念、起源和发展历史。掌握Job的基本功能和配置文件。精通Job任务管理学习Job的任务类型、设置方法和监控管理。掌握Job任务的错误处理和扩展。熟练Job服务器配置了解Job服务器的配置、高可用和安全配置。学习Job的最佳实践。掌握Job应用实践学习Job与其他系统的集成。掌握Job的常见问题和解决方案。什么是Job自动化任务Job代表一个自动化任务,能够自动执行一系列操作,例如数据处理、系统监控或文件传输。预定执行时间Job可以设置在特定时间或时间间隔内执行,例如每天、每周或每月执行。流程化执行Job通常定义为一个流程,由一系列步骤组成,每个步骤执行特定的操作,确保整个任务的顺利完成。Job的起源Job的概念起源于早期的批处理系统,这些系统用于处理大量的数据,例如财务报表、科学计算、数据分析等等。1批处理系统早期数据处理方式2任务调度提高数据处理效率3Job概念代表一个完整的任务Job的概念在当时被用来代表一个完整的任务,包含了数据、程序以及执行参数等信息。这些任务会在特定的时间点被调度执行,从而实现自动化处理。Job的发展历程1早期Job最初是作为一种简单的任务调度工具出现,主要用于在特定时间执行简单的任务。例如,在特定时间发送电子邮件或执行简单的脚本。2发展阶段随着技术的进步,Job逐渐发展成为一种功能强大的任务调度框架,支持更复杂的任务类型,例如数据处理、文件传输、数据库操作等。3现代阶段现代Job框架通常具有分布式、高可用性、可扩展性等特点,可以满足各种复杂的任务调度需求。Job的基本功能11.任务调度Job能够自动执行预定的任务,无需人工干预。22.任务监控Job可以监控任务执行状态,并提供详细的日志记录。33.任务管理Job支持创建、修改、删除、暂停、恢复等任务管理功能。44.任务执行Job可以执行各种类型的任务,包括脚本、程序、数据处理等。Job的配置文件YAML配置Job任务使用YAML格式的配置文件来定义任务参数、依赖关系和执行策略。任务调度配置文件中指定任务的调度方式,例如定期执行、一次性执行、触发执行等。任务依赖可以定义任务之间的依赖关系,例如任务A必须在任务B执行完成后才能执行。错误处理配置文件中定义了任务执行过程中遇到错误时的处理方式,例如重试、失败通知等。Job的任务类型数据处理任务处理数据文件或数据库,进行数据清洗、转换、分析等操作。系统维护任务定期监控系统状态,执行备份、更新、修复等操作。应用开发任务部署和管理应用,例如网站、应用程序、API等。数据备份任务定期备份重要数据,确保数据安全,防止数据丢失。定期任务的设置方法配置任务周期您可以根据需求设置任务执行频率,例如每天、每周或每月。设置启动时间指定任务开始执行的具体时间,例如每天的凌晨1点或每个月的第一个星期一。定义任务依赖如果有必要,可以将任务设置为依赖其他任务的完成,确保执行顺序正确。设置任务参数根据任务类型和需求,配置相关的参数,例如数据源地址、输出路径等。保存任务配置保存您所设置的定期任务配置信息,以便系统能够根据配置自动执行任务。一次性任务的设置方法1创建任务选择“一次性任务”类型。2配置参数设置任务名称、执行时间和目标任务。3提交任务点击“提交”按钮,启动一次性任务。一次性任务是指仅执行一次的任务。设置时,需要指定任务名称、执行时间和目标任务。在配置完成后,点击“提交”按钮即可启动一次性任务。一次性任务的执行时间可以是立即执行或者指定未来的某个时间点。并发任务的设置方法定义并发任务在Job配置文件中,为并发任务指定唯一的标识符和执行的具体任务。配置并发执行数量根据实际需求设置并发任务的执行数量,例如设置同时执行5个任务。设置任务依赖关系如果有任务依赖关系,需在配置文件中定义依赖关系,确保任务按照顺序执行。监控任务状态使用Job监控系统实时监控并发任务的运行状态,例如任务执行进度和错误信息。定时任务的设置方法1选择触发器根据需求,选择合适的触发器类型2配置任务设置任务执行时间、参数和依赖关系3添加任务将任务添加到任务列表中,并启动任务定时任务可以通过多种触发器类型来触发,例如时间触发器、cron表达式触发器等,选择合适的触发器类型是设置定时任务的关键。配置任务时,需要设置任务执行时间、参数和依赖关系,以确保任务能够按预期执行。最后将任务添加到任务列表中,并启动任务,即可完成定时任务的设置。Job任务的监控实时监控通过监控面板实时显示任务状态,包括运行时间、进度、资源使用情况等。日志记录记录Job任务的执行日志,包括开始时间、结束时间、执行结果、异常信息等,便于排查问题。告警机制当任务出现异常或运行状态不符合预期时,及时触发告警,提醒相关人员进行处理。数据可视化将监控数据进行可视化展示,方便直观地了解任务运行情况,及时发现潜在问题。Job任务的错误处理错误日志记录记录所有Job任务错误,方便排查问题。记录错误信息,如时间、任务名称、错误类型、错误堆栈。使用日志记录框架,方便管理和分析日志信息。错误重试机制对于可重试的错误,设置重试次数和间隔时间。重试机制可以提高任务的成功率。避免因瞬时错误而导致任务失败。Job任务的扩展11.任务参数可以添加新的参数,以便在运行时调整任务的行为。22.任务依赖可以将多个任务链接在一起,以便在完成一个任务后自动执行另一个任务。33.任务日志可以记录任务的执行过程和结果,以便于排查问题和监控任务状态。44.任务监控可以添加监控功能,以便实时了解任务的执行状态和性能。Job任务的优化提高执行效率优化代码逻辑,减少资源消耗,例如,使用更快的算法或数据结构,优化数据库查询语句等。减少错误率完善错误处理机制,降低错误发生率,确保任务稳定运行。提升并发能力合理设计任务并发执行策略,例如,使用线程池或异步处理等技术,提高整体执行效率。降低资源占用优化内存使用,减少资源浪费,提高系统稳定性。Job任务的故障排查日志分析检查Job日志,识别错误信息和异常行为。监控指标查看关键指标,如执行时间、资源使用率和任务状态。环境检查确认Job运行环境是否正常,例如网络连接、磁盘空间和依赖服务。代码调试如果日志无法提供足够信息,可进行代码调试,定位具体问题。Job服务器的配置11.硬件配置选择性能稳定、可靠性高的服务器,满足Job执行的内存、CPU和存储需求。22.操作系统选择适合Job运行环境的操作系统,安装必要的依赖库和软件。33.数据库配置配置数据库连接,确保Job能正常访问数据库,保存执行状态和日志。44.网络配置配置网络连接,保证Job服务器能与其他系统正常通信。Job服务器的高可用冗余备份配置多个Job服务器,确保数据和服务冗余,防止单点故障。实时监控监控服务器运行状况,及时发现并解决问题。自动故障转移当某个服务器出现故障时,自动切换到其他服务器,确保服务不中断。负载均衡将任务分配到不同的服务器,提高处理能力。Job的安全配置数据加密敏感数据进行加密,保护数据安全。访问控制设置访问权限,限制非法访问。身份验证验证用户身份,确保操作合法性。安全审计记录所有操作日志,便于排查问题。Job的最佳实践代码规范使用统一的编码风格和注释规范,方便维护和调试。编写简洁高效的代码,提高程序的执行效率。任务规划合理规划任务流程,避免过度依赖单个节点。做好任务的依赖关系管理,防止任务执行顺序错误。Job与其他系统的集成11.数据集成Job可与数据库、消息队列等系统集成,实现数据交换和同步。22.流程集成Job可与工作流引擎集成,实现复杂业务流程的自动化管理。33.监控集成Job可与监控系统集成,实现任务执行状态的实时监控和告警。44.安全集成Job可与身份认证和授权系统集成,保障任务执行的安全性和可靠性。Job的常见问题与解决方案Job在实际应用中可能会遇到各种问题。常见问题包括任务执行失败、任务超时、任务资源不足等等。这些问题可以通过合理配置、代码优化以及监控手段来解决。例如,任务执行失败可能是由于代码逻辑错误、依赖服务不可用或资源限制导致。针对这些问题,可以进行代码调试、检查依赖服务状态以及调整资源配置等。此外,还需要加强对Job的监控,及时发现问题并进行处理。可以设置监控指标,例如任务执行时间、任务成功率、资源使用率等等,并根据指标的波动情况采取相应的措施。Job的成功案例分享案例分享能帮助观众更直观地理解Job的应用场景以及带来的实际效益。例如,某电商平台使用Job进行商品数据分析,每天处理海量数据,提高了运营效率。另一个案例是使用Job进行网站日志分析,帮助企业了解用户行为,提升用户体验。Job的发展趋势云原生Job任务将越来越多地运行在云平台上,充分利用云计算的弹性、可扩展性和安全性。人工智能AI技术将与Job任务结合,实现更智能化的自动化,例如自动任务调度、优化和故障处理。分布式架构Job任务将采用分布式架构,提高处理效率和容错能力,应对日益增长的数据量和复杂性。可视化管理Job任务管理将更加可视化,方便用户监控、分析和操作,提升管理效率和透明度。课程总结Job概念学习了Job的定义、起源和发展历程,理解了Job在现代软件开发中的重要作用。Job功能掌握了Job的基本功能,包括任务调度、任务执行、任务监控和错误处理等。实践操作通过实践练习,学会了配置Job任务、设置定时任务、监控任务执行情况以及处理任务错误。心得体会学习Job,提升工作效率。掌握Job,解决工作难题。使用Job,协同团队合作。Job助力未来职业发展。问答交流这是一个与学员进行互动和交流的环节。教师可以解答学员在学习过程中遇到的问题,并就相关技术问题展开讨论。学员可以提出自己的疑问、困惑,并与教师和其他学员进行交流学习。问答交
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 浙江省杭州市景成实验校2024-2025学年初三考前抢分(三)语文试题含解析
- 招远市2025年四下数学期末复习检测模拟试题含解析
- 汽车配件购销合同范本
- 庐江县重点名校2025届初三第二次模拟考试英语试题含答案
- 江苏省苏州市葛江中学2025届初三下学期联合考试生物试题含解析
- 宁波市重点中学2024-2025学年初三3月教学质量检查化学试题含解析
- 盐城市亭湖区2025届初三5月阶段性检测试题语文试题含解析
- 云南省丽江市重点名校2024-2025学年初三7月四校联考化学试题含解析
- 烘焙食品加工合作协议
- 货物供应合同附加协议范本
- GB/Z 18462-2001激光加工机械金属切割的性能规范与标准检查程序
- GB/T 4457.4-2002机械制图图样画法图线
- GA/T 1567-2019城市道路交通隔离栏设置指南
- QCC培训教材-经典实用资料课件
- 玻璃水汽车风窗玻璃清洗剂检验报告单
- 人力资源部部长岗位廉洁风险点排查
- PPT公路工程施工常见质量通病与防治措施(图文并茂)
- 提升中西医协同协作能力实施方案
- 热烈欢迎某某公司领导莅临指导
- 多旋翼理论-AOPA考证试题库(含答案)
- 电解铝供电整流系统的优化改造
评论
0/150
提交评论